Jana Nayagan (Tamil pronunciation: [dʑanaː n̪aːjagan]; transl. People's Hero) is an upcoming Indian Tamil-language political action thriller film directed by H. Vinoth and produced by KVN Productions. The film stars Vijay, Pooja Hegde, Bobby Deol and Mamitha Baiju, alongside Gautham Vasudev Menon, Prakash Raj, Narain and Priyamani. A partial remake of the 2023 Telugu film Bhagavanth Kesari, it was intended to be the final film appearance of Vijay before his transition into politics and the first film to be released after he became the Chief Minister of Tamil Nadu. It is also the first production of KVN Productions in Tamil cinema. The film was officially announced in September 2024 under the tentative title Thalapathy 69, due to it being Vijay's 69th film as a lead actor, and the official title was announced in January 2025. Principal photography commenced in October 2024 in Chennai continued by a schedule in Payanoor, which was again followed by two additional schedules also held at the former location, and wrapped by August 2025. The film has music composed by Anirudh Ravichander, cinematography handled by Sathyan Sooryan and editing by Pradeep E. Ragav. Initially scheduled for release on 9 January 2026, the release of the film was delayed for several months due to issues between the producers and the Central Board of Film Certification (CBFC). The entire film was leaked online on 9 April 2026 and widely pirated and distributed illegally, leading to the producers to seek legal action against social media accounts that shared clips or links to the film. The film was reported to have become a loss-making venture even before its release, largely due to the online leak. In July, the censorship issues were rectified, with the film now set for release on 24 July 2026. (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
